Okay, let’s be real. We all have that one thing, that kryptonite, that weakness that turns us into blithering, giggling idiots. For some, it's a perfectly aged cheese. For others, it's a vintage car. For me? It's my daughter. Plain and simple. My precious, opinionated, spaghetti-loving little girl.

Before she arrived, I envisioned myself as a pillar of stoicism, a model of parental control. I pictured calm discussions, reasoned arguments, and a household run with the efficiency of a Swiss watch. HA! The universe clearly has a sense of humor.

The reality? I’m more like a wind-up toy that’s been wound too tight, then dangled in front of a particularly enthusiastic cat. I'm all over the place! My carefully constructed facade of adult responsibility crumbles the moment those big, innocent eyes lock onto mine. Suddenly, I'm negotiating the price of broccoli (apparently, dinosaur-shaped florets warrant a premium), singing off-key Disney songs at the top of my lungs, and agreeing to build a fort out of every blanket in the house.

It's embarrassing, really. I'm a reasonably intelligent person (I think!). I can hold my own in a debate, navigate complex spreadsheets, and even parallel park (most of the time). But when my daughter asks me to "be the horsey" and trot around the living room with her clinging to my back? My IQ plummets faster than a lead balloon dropped from the Empire State Building. There I am, a grown man, neighing like a deranged pony, all for the sake of a smile.

Seriously, I transform. I've been a pirate captain searching for buried treasure (aka, stray Cheerios under the sofa), a majestic dragon guarding a cardboard box castle, and a talking tree dispensing sage advice (usually involving the proper application of glitter). I've even willingly eaten questionable concoctions involving ketchup, sprinkles, and mashed bananas. And enjoyed it! (Okay, maybe not enjoyed it, but I certainly pretended to.)

And don’t even get me started on the fashion choices. I’ve rocked a tutu (briefly, thank goodness), sported a tiara (slightly less briefly), and even allowed my face to be decorated with a rainbow of glitter and stick-on gems. The photos are… incriminating, to say the least.

My wife just shakes her head and laughs. She sees it all. The complete and utter transformation. The way my voice goes up three octaves when I'm talking to my daughter. The way I suddenly develop a deep and abiding interest in all things Paw Patrol. The way I melt into a puddle of goo whenever she says, "I love you, Daddy."

It’s a weakness, I admit it.

But it's a weakness I wouldn't trade for anything. This foolishness, this willingness to be utterly ridiculous, is part of what makes being a dad so amazing. It's about letting go of your inhibitions, embracing the silliness, and seeing the world through the eyes of a child.

It’s about creating memories, fostering joy, and building a bond that will last a lifetime. It’s about showing my daughter that I’m not just her dad, but also her biggest fan, her playmate, and her partner in crime.

So, the next time you see me wearing a princess crown and pretending to be a unicorn, just smile and nod. You’ll understand. Because somewhere in your life, there’s probably a little person (or a golden retriever, no judgment!) who turns you into a complete and utter fool, too. And isn't that just the best?

The truth is, I'm not really a fool. I’m just a dad. And being a dad means embracing the ridiculous. It means putting your own dignity aside for a few precious moments and joining your child in their world of imagination and wonder. And honestly? There's no smarter thing I could do.
